THE ROLE:
This is an exciting opportunity for a talented Property Litigation Solicitor to join a thriving and dynamic dispute resolution team. The successful candidate will manage a broad caseload of contentious property matters, including landlord and tenant disputes (both commercial and residential), rent recovery, possession and forfeiture claims, enforcement of easements and restrictive covenants, beneficial interest disputes, and party wall matters. Experience in construction-related disputes would also be an advantage.
